Transaction 3dc1bc5a28c63dfada261a0d8b34041474be31dabc229e127b95c2eba9554b1b
1 Input
1 Output
-
3dc1bc5a28c63dfada261a0d8b34041474be31dabc229e127b95c2eba9554b1b:0
- value
- 13563
- script pubkey
- OP_0 OP_PUSHBYTES_32 8cbf178be04a272dcc0372cb6e821a80687d56a68a67246ae4cc32fe518a9ecd
- address
- bc1q3jl30zlqfgnjmnqrwt9kaqs6sp58644x3fnjg6hyese0u5v2nmxsxrqmpq